Add 27/42 and 4/14
27/42 + 4/14 is 13/14.
Steps for adding fractions
- Find the least common denominator or LCM of the two denominators:
LCM of 42 and 14 is 42
Next, find the equivalent fraction of both fractional numbers with denominator 42 - For the 1st fraction, since 42 × 1 = 42,
27/42 = 27 × 1/42 × 1 = 27/42 - Likewise, for the 2nd fraction, since 14 × 3 = 42,
4/14 = 4 × 3/14 × 3 = 12/42 - Add the two like fractions:
27/42 + 12/42 = 27 + 12/42 = 39/42 - 39/42 simplified gives 13/14
- So, 27/42 + 4/14 = 13/14
